Exploring Cognitive Buddhism : Through Neurobiology & Vipassana
by Nazir Brelvi
Other Available Formats
Overview
In this latest book in the Cognition/Consciousness series, Dr. Brelvi hopes to reconcile the various scientific and religious thoughts in order to seek new and innovative answers to the age-old questions that have been lingering in our social consciousness since the ancient Egyptian, Greek and Hindu mythologies.
